Standard oxygen therapy delivered through a nasal cannula or another device, such as a non-rebreather mask (NRBM), delivers cold (not warmed) and dry (not humidified) gas. This cold, dry gas can lead to airway inflammation, increase airway resistance, and impair mucociliary function, possibly impairing secretion clearance .

Growth of adipose tissue is the result of the development of new fat cells from precursor cells. This process of fat cell development, known as adipogenesis, leads to the accumulation of lipids and an increase in the number and size of fat cells.
Orlistat interacts with enzymes to assist stop the breakdown of fat. In order to block the digestion of 30% of the fat that is consumed, orlistat (Xenical) binds to pancreatic and stomach lipase. This lowers calorie intake.
Orlistat medicine aids in weight loss when combined with a reduced-calorie diet, exercise regimen, and behavioural changes recommended by your doctor. Some overweight persons, such as those who are obese or have health issues related to their weight, use it. Additionally, taking orlistat can prevent you from gaining the weight you've already lost back. The numerous health concerns associated with obesity, such as heart disease, diabetes, high blood pressure, and a shortened lifespan, can be reduced by losing weight and keeping it off. Before being absorbed by the body, dietary fats must first be broken down into smaller bits. Orlistat functions by preventing the enzyme that breaks down dietary lipids. Following that, this undigested fat is eliminated from your body by bowel movements. Since orlistat does not prevent the absorption of calories from sugar and other non-fat meals, you must still limit your overall calorie consumption.

ICD-10 is a standardized system established to be adopted internationally. It is used in the medical field and aims to establish a standard that facilitates healthcare professionals in obtaining information on collection, classification, processing and statistics on healthcare, quality of treatments and equipment, mortality and billing.
